Minimum Requirements
- Master's Deg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ited educational program
- Completed CFY and current Certificate of Clinical Competence from ASHA
- Active State License is Required to Start the Assignment
- BLS Certification May Be Required from AHA or ARC

Location Highlights
Glen Burnie offers access to both Baltimore and the Chesapeake Bay region. Downtown Baltimore, including the Inner Harbor and Camden Yards, is about 20 minutes away, and Baltimore/Washington International Thurgood Marshall Airport is located nearby for convenient regional travel. Sandy Point State Park is about 30 miles away and provides Chesapeake Bay beaches and waterfront recreation, while Patapsco Valley State Park offers hiking and outdoor access within a short drive. Annapolis is about 25 minutes away and features the City Dock waterfront and the United States Naval Academy, making the area a fit for travelers who want suburban access with nearby coastal and urban attractions.
